    This paper is concerned with the study of rational transformations of linear functionals. This is a very well written paper which describes the following situation. For a regular and hermitian functional \(u\), it is considered a new linear functional \(\mathcal{L}\) defined by means of the following relations with \(u\): \[ \lambda (z-\beta)\mathcal{L}=(z-\alpha)u, \] with \(\alpha, \beta, \lambda \in \mathbb{C}\) and \(\lambda \neq 0.\) A necessary and sufficient condition for the regularity of \(\mathcal{L}\) is obtained and the positive definite character of \( \mathcal{L}\) is also studied. Some linear relations linking the sequences of orthogonal polynomials related to \(\mathcal{L}\) and \(u\) are obtained as well as an explicit representation for the orthogonal polynomial sequences of second kind related to \(\mathcal{L}\). Finally, the particular case \(\alpha=\beta\) is analyzed. In this last situation \(\mathcal{L}\) becomes in the modification of \(u\) by addition of a Dirac delta.
